How much do remote implementation man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ote implementation manager in Southaven, MS is $97,313.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$71,000.00 and $113,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ote implementation manager?

A Remote Implementation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the deployment and integration of products, services, or software solutions for clients, all while working remotely. They coordinate project timelines, manage client relationships, and ensure successful onboarding and adoption of solutions. Their role involves collaborating with cross-functional teams, troubleshooting issues, and providing training and support to clients to ensure a smooth implementation process. Strong communication, project management, and technical skills are essential for this position.

What does a remote implementation manager do?

As a remote implementation manager, you work from home to direct the implementation of a new system or process in a company or organization. Your duties vary depending on the needs of each client or customer, but you typically lead a team of specialists during an implementation project. In general, your responsibilities include creating a budget for the implementation project, providing necessary training and information, and helping troubleshoot until the new system gets fully integrated. Some implementation specialists help companies transfer to new software, hardware, or network systems, while others specialize in business or manufacturing processes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ote implementation man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Implementation Manager, you need strong project management abilities, knowledge of implementation methodologies, and typically a bachelor’s degree in business, IT, or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ools (e.g., Asana, Jira), CRM systems, and sometimes relevant certifications like PMP are important.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and organizational skills help foster client relationships and manage cross-functional teams remotely. Mastering these skills ensures seamless client onboarding, timely project delivery, and high customer satisfaction in a distributed work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by remote implementation managers and how can they be addressed?

Remote Implementation Managers often encounter challenges such as coordinating across different time zones, ensuring effective communication with clients and internal teams, and maintaining project timelines without in-person oversight. To address these, it’s important to leverage collaboration tools, set clear expectations, and establish regular check-ins. Proactively managing stakeholder relationships and documenting processes thoroughly can also help ensure smooth project delivery and client satisfaction, even while working remotely.

What is the difference between Remote Implementation Manager vs Remote Project Coordinator?

AspectRemote Implementation ManagerRemote Project Coordinator
Required CredentialsProject management certification (PMP), industry-specific knowledgeBasic project management skills, often a bachelor's degree
Work EnvironmentLeads implementation teams, manages client onboarding, oversees project executionSupports project tasks, coordinates schedules, assists with communication
Employer & Industry UsageTechnology, healthcare, software companiesVarious industries including IT, marketing, and services
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ding roles in project implementation, leadership scopeSupporting roles, coordination tasks, entry-level project work

The Remote Implementation Manager typically oversees project execution, manages teams, and ensures successful client onboarding, requiring certifications like PMP. In contrast, the Remote Project Coordinator supports project activities, handles scheduling, and assists project managers. Both roles are vital in project delivery but differ in responsibility level and scope.
